Ministry of Commerce Targets 80% Governance Implementation by 2026 and 2027

KUNA – The Ministry of Commerce and Industry issued a decision on Sunday to form a Corporate Governance Team, chaired by the Undersecretary of the Ministry and comprising directors of relevant departments and specialists in governance programs, as part of efforts to follow up on the implementation of the National Corporate Governance Program with the Civil Service Bureau.

The ministry stated that the implementation rate of corporate governance within the ministry reached 61 percent in 2025, an increase of 8 percent compared to 2024.

It emphasized its commitment to raising the implementation rate to 80 percent during 2026 and 2027 by enhancing institutional capacity development and intensifying training programs aimed at improving employees’ skills in applying governance principles, as well as establishing a clear regulatory framework to support the strengthening of governance principles.

The ministry added that the team aims to promote a culture of corporate governance within the ministry by raising awareness of its principles across all its sectors, enabling active participation through involving employees and relevant stakeholders in decision-making processes, and fostering a collaborative work environment that contributes to improving institutional performance.

It further noted that the team also contributes to building a clear accountability system to ensure efficient institutional performance, clarify responsibilities and authorities at all levels of the ministry, and improve the quality of services provided by applying best governance standards.
